Title:
  No Preference to "Show Text Location instead of Buttons"

Status in “nautilus” package in Ubuntu:
  New

Bug description:
  I'm one who doesn't like the trend where file explorers are using buttons 
(exclusively) to represent the current hierarchical location you're at in the 
file system. Instead, I like to see the text representation of the path like 
this:
  /home/user/

  Unfortunately, there is no way (I've found) to set my preference in
  Nautilus.

  To see what I'd prefer, you can go here in the menu:
  Files > Enter Location

  But there is no way to set this view as default.

  I do see certain advantages to the button-hierarchy method, in that
  you can click any button to go to a particular place in the hierarchy.
  But often I despise the fact that these buttons do not have enough
  room to display the complete path back to root.

  There needs to be a "View > Toolbars" (similar to options you'd see
  the Firefox). This could potentially allow you to see both
  representations of the path at the same time.
